Solution for 2x^2+x-1=2x^2-3x+1 equation:


Simplifying
2x2 + x + -1 = 2x2 + -3x + 1

Reorder the terms:
-1 + x + 2x2 = 2x2 + -3x + 1

Reorder the terms:
-1 + x + 2x2 = 1 + -3x + 2x2

Add '-2x2' to each side of the equation.
-1 + x + 2x2 + -2x2 = 1 + -3x + 2x2 + -2x2

Combine like terms: 2x2 + -2x2 = 0
-1 + x + 0 = 1 + -3x + 2x2 + -2x2
-1 + x = 1 + -3x + 2x2 + -2x2

Combine like terms: 2x2 + -2x2 = 0
-1 + x = 1 + -3x + 0
-1 + x = 1 + -3x

Solving
-1 + x = 1 + -3x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'3x' to each side of the equation.
-1 + x + 3x = 1 + -3x + 3x

Combine like terms: x + 3x = 4x
-1 + 4x = 1 + -3x + 3x

Combine like terms: -3x + 3x = 0
-1 + 4x = 1 + 0
-1 + 4x = 1

Add '1' to each side of the equation.
-1 + 1 + 4x = 1 + 1

Combine like terms: -1 + 1 = 0
0 + 4x = 1 + 1
4x = 1 + 1

Combine like terms: 1 + 1 = 2
4x = 2

Divide each side by '4'.
x = 0.5

Simplifying
x = 0.5
